python中,怎么将大量数据一次性导入数据库中。 补充:数据库是Mysql数据库

 我来答
那个睡着的姑娘
推荐于2016-01-01 · TA获得超过311个赞
知道小有建树答主
回答量:97
采纳率:0%
帮助的人:81.6万
展开全部
我估计你是问怎么从文件导入到数据库。一般每个数据库都有一个从文件直接load数据到数据库的命令或者工具。
比如SQLServer 有个bcp。 MySql 就是 load。

给你搜了详细的帮助。看看链接吧。以下是精简的使用方法:
基本用法:
mysql> USE db1;
mysql> LOAD DATA INFILE "./data.txt" INTO TABLE db2.my_table;

指定行,字段的分隔符:
mysql> LOAD DATA INFILE 'data.txt' INTO TABLE tbl_name

FIELDS TERMINATED BY ',' ENCLOSED BY '"'

LINES TERMINATED BY '\n';
追问
补充:意思是在Django页面上,获取文本或者excel表,在点一下按钮就直接入库。也许我说的简单做起来难,也许我提的不符合逻辑,请大家点评,谢谢
追答
你补充的功能大概要你自己另外实现。至于你说的“点一下按钮就入库”的功能,它的实现依赖我上一次的回答内容。

参考资料: http://www.dabaoku.com/jiaocheng/biancheng/mysql/201003064507.shtml

本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式